WebJun 24, 2024 · In addition to fluorescent proteins, there is a group of GFP-like colored chromoproteins that are not fluorescent. In chromoproteins, the chromophore’s Tyr residue as a rule is in the trans protonated state stabilized by H-bonds with amino acid residues of the immediate neighborhood.

WebThe two-ring chromophore is formed by oxidation and cyclization of the backbone of 3 amino acids: Threonine 65, Tyrosine 66, and Glycine 67.
